Hiding users from a channel can be super useful for various reasons. Whether you're managing a large online community, moderating a forum, or just trying to keep things organized, knowing how to control who sees what is key. In this guide, we'll dive into different ways you can hide users from a channel, why you might want to do it, and some best practices to keep in mind. So, let's get started!
Why Hide Users from a Channel?
There are several compelling reasons why you might want to hide users from a channel. Understanding these can help you decide if this is the right approach for your situation.
Moderation and Privacy
One of the most common reasons to hide users is for moderation purposes. Imagine you're running a large online forum, and you have a user who consistently violates the community guidelines. Instead of outright banning them (which can sometimes cause backlash), you might choose to hide their posts and activity from the main channel. This way, other users won't be exposed to their disruptive behavior, and the overall experience remains positive. Privacy is another crucial factor. Some users might prefer to remain anonymous within a channel. Hiding their presence can help protect their identity and prevent unwanted attention. For instance, in a support group channel, individuals might feel more comfortable sharing their experiences if they know their participation is discreet. Hiding users can also prevent targeted harassment or bullying. By making a user's presence less visible, you reduce the chances of them becoming a target for negative interactions. This is particularly important in communities focused on sensitive topics, where users might be more vulnerable.
Content Control and Organization
Sometimes, hiding users is about maintaining the quality and relevance of content within a channel. For example, if you have a channel dedicated to expert discussions, you might hide contributions from users who are new to the topic or haven't yet demonstrated a solid understanding. This ensures that the channel remains focused on high-quality insights and avoids overwhelming other users with irrelevant or inaccurate information. Content control also extends to managing spam and irrelevant posts. Hiding these types of contributions can keep the channel clean and organized, making it easier for users to find valuable information. In a professional setting, hiding users might be necessary to control access to sensitive information. For example, you might have a channel where confidential project details are discussed. Hiding the presence of users who are not authorized to access this information helps prevent leaks and ensures that only relevant personnel are involved.
Channel Management and Roles
Effective channel management often involves assigning different roles and permissions to users. Hiding users can be a way to delineate these roles and ensure that each member has access to the appropriate level of visibility. For example, you might have a channel where only moderators can see certain administrative discussions. Hiding regular users from these discussions ensures that they are not distracted by irrelevant information and that moderators can communicate freely without causing confusion or concern. Hiding users can also help streamline communication within a channel. By limiting the number of visible participants, you can reduce the potential for unnecessary back-and-forth and ensure that discussions remain focused and productive. This is particularly useful in channels with a high volume of activity, where it can be challenging to keep track of who is participating and what their roles are.
Methods to Hide Users
Alright, now that we know why you might want to hide users from a channel, let’s talk about how to actually do it. The methods available will depend on the platform or software you’re using.
Platform-Specific Features
Many platforms offer built-in features for managing user visibility within channels. For instance, Slack allows you to create private channels where only invited members can see the content and participants. Similarly, Discord offers role-based permissions that can restrict who can view certain channels or interact with specific users. These platform-specific features are often the easiest and most effective way to hide users, as they are designed to integrate seamlessly with the existing functionality. Before exploring more complex methods, it’s always a good idea to check what options are available directly within your chosen platform. For example, in Microsoft Teams, you can create private teams, which function similarly to private channels in Slack. This ensures that only authorized members can access the team's channels and resources. In forum software like phpBB or vBulletin, you can assign users to specific groups and then restrict access to certain forums based on group membership. This allows you to create hidden forums that are only visible to certain users.
Third-Party Plugins and Bots
If your platform doesn’t offer the built-in features you need, you might consider using third-party plugins or bots. These tools can add extra functionality to your channel, including the ability to hide users or restrict access to certain content. For example, there are Discord bots that allow you to hide the presence of certain users or automatically delete messages that violate community guidelines. When choosing a third-party plugin or bot, it’s essential to do your research and ensure that the tool is reputable and secure. Look for reviews from other users and check the developer's credentials before installing anything. Also, be sure to understand the tool's privacy policy and how it handles user data. Some popular options include moderation bots for Discord and Slack, which offer advanced features for managing user permissions and content visibility. These bots often come with customizable settings that allow you to tailor their behavior to your specific needs. For example, you can configure the bot to automatically hide messages from new users or to restrict access to certain channels based on user roles.
Custom Solutions and APIs
For more advanced users, creating custom solutions using APIs can be a powerful way to hide users from a channel. This approach requires some programming knowledge but offers the greatest flexibility and control. Most platforms offer APIs that allow you to interact with their services programmatically. You can use these APIs to create scripts or applications that automatically manage user visibility based on specific criteria. For example, you could write a script that automatically hides the presence of users who have been flagged for violating community guidelines. When working with APIs, it’s crucial to follow best practices for security and data privacy. Be sure to authenticate your requests properly and handle user data in a responsible manner. Also, be aware of the platform's API usage limits and avoid making excessive requests that could overload the system. Custom solutions can be particularly useful in large organizations where there is a need to integrate user management with other systems. For example, you could create a script that automatically synchronizes user permissions across multiple channels or platforms. This ensures that users have consistent access to the resources they need, regardless of where they are working.
Best Practices
Before you go all-in on hiding users from a channel, let’s cover some best practices to make sure you’re doing it right. These tips will help you maintain a healthy and transparent community.
Transparency and Communication
Whenever you’re implementing measures that affect user visibility, it’s essential to be transparent and communicate clearly with your community. Explain why you’re hiding users and what the criteria are for being hidden. This helps prevent misunderstandings and builds trust among your users. For example, you might create a public announcement explaining that you will be hiding posts from users who consistently violate the community guidelines. This gives users a clear understanding of the rules and the consequences of breaking them. It’s also a good idea to provide a way for users to appeal decisions about their visibility. This shows that you’re willing to listen to feedback and address any concerns that may arise. For example, you might create a dedicated channel or email address where users can submit appeals. Transparency also extends to documenting your policies and procedures for hiding users. This ensures that everyone is on the same page and that decisions are made consistently and fairly. For example, you might create a document outlining the criteria for being hidden, the process for appealing decisions, and the roles and responsibilities of moderators.
Consistent Application
Consistency is key when it comes to hiding users. Apply your policies fairly and evenly to all users, regardless of their status or popularity. This helps prevent accusations of favoritism and ensures that everyone is treated equally. For example, if you have a rule against posting spam, apply that rule consistently to all users who violate it, regardless of whether they are new members or long-time contributors. Consistency also extends to documenting your decisions and the reasons behind them. This helps you track your actions and ensures that you can justify your decisions if they are challenged. For example, you might create a log of all users who have been hidden, along with the reasons for their removal. This log can be invaluable in resolving disputes and demonstrating that you are applying your policies fairly.
Regular Review and Adjustment
Your community is constantly evolving, so it’s important to regularly review and adjust your policies for hiding users. What works today might not work tomorrow, so stay flexible and be willing to adapt to changing circumstances. For example, you might find that your initial criteria for hiding users are too strict or too lenient. Based on feedback from your community, you might need to adjust these criteria to better reflect the needs and values of your users. Regular review also extends to evaluating the effectiveness of your policies. Are they actually achieving their intended goals? Are they having any unintended consequences? By monitoring the impact of your policies, you can identify areas for improvement and make necessary adjustments. For example, you might find that hiding users is not effectively reducing spam or harassment. In this case, you might need to explore alternative strategies, such as implementing stricter moderation policies or investing in more advanced filtering tools.
By following these best practices, you can effectively hide users from a channel while maintaining a healthy and transparent community.
In Conclusion
Hiding users from a channel can be a powerful tool for moderation, content control, and channel management. By understanding the reasons for doing so, exploring the available methods, and following best practices, you can create a more positive and productive environment for your online community. Whether you’re using platform-specific features, third-party plugins, or custom solutions, remember to prioritize transparency, consistency, and regular review. Happy managing, guys!
Lastest News
-
-
Related News
Gold Card Vs. EB1/EB2: The Future Of US Immigration?
Alex Braham - Nov 13, 2025 52 Views -
Related News
Felix Auger-Aliassime's Net Worth: Career Earnings & Financials
Alex Braham - Nov 9, 2025 63 Views -
Related News
Off Road Jeep Renegade Bumper: Ultimate Guide
Alex Braham - Nov 13, 2025 45 Views -
Related News
Microfinance Banks Operating In The USA
Alex Braham - Nov 13, 2025 39 Views -
Related News
PHP Quraner Alo 2021: Grand Finale Highlights
Alex Braham - Nov 9, 2025 45 Views